What is a hands free prostate massage device

A hands free prostate massage device is a designed retention tool that sits inside the anal passage and targets the prostate with precise pressure and angles. The design allows the user to enjoy stimulation without actively moving the device with their hands. Most devices are shaped like a curved wand with a stabilizing flange and a tail that rests comfortably between the cheeks. The goal is to create steady contact with the prostate while allowing the pelvic floor and surrounding muscles to naturally do the work. With practice these devices deliver intense waves of pressure that push you toward powerful internal orgasms and deeper sensations.

Aneros line up explained for beginners

Understanding the different shapes and purposes helps you choose what fits your body and your level of experience. Here are the main models you will encounter along with what they are best suited for.

MGX and MGX 3

The MGX family is a great starting point for beginners who want a compact shape that still delivers strong contact with the prostate. The MGX line generally offers straightforward insertion, a gentle curve, and a smooth surface that makes it easy to learn the basics of internal stimulation. For a first timer the MGX models provide reliable feedback without overwhelming dimensions. As your comfort grows you can experiment with more complex curves from the same family to escalate intensity while preserving the hands free experience.

Helix and Helix Syn

The Helix lineup is a favorite among more experienced users who want a slightly larger profile and a broader contact surface. The Helix is known for its generous curve that meets the prostate at a satisfying angle while staying comfortable for longer sessions. The Syn variant adds a more flexible neck and a slightly different weight distribution which can translate into different movement patterns during play. If you enjoy stronger internal contact with a smooth ride the Helix family is worth exploring as your next step.

Eupho and Eupho Syn

Eupho devices are all about precision with a long curving shaft designed to find the prostate with a targeted touch. Eupho is often described as ideal for users who appreciate a refined feel and greater maneuverability. The Syn version offers a more modern construction and sometimes a lighter in hand feel making it easier to guide during long sessions while keeping the hands free benefit intact. Eupho models are a strong choice for players who want a balance of control and subtlety in their hands free experience.

Progasm and Progasm ICE

Progasm series tends to be larger and heavier with a stronger emphasis on deeper stimulation. The classic Progasm is renowned for its pronounced curve and a robust presence that can deliver powerful sensations when you are ready. The ICE version adds a cooling touch and a slightly different texture which some players find more comfortable for longer wear. If you are curious about intense prostate contact and you already have some experience with smaller models this family offers a satisfying progression option while preserving hands free capability.

Max and other specialty shapes

The Max line brings a chunkier shape that can press against the prostate from multiple angles. The broader surface can create a more diffuse but deeply satisfying pressure while still allowing hands free control. The overall idea is to experiment with different geometry until you discover which contour your body resonates with most. Some players enjoy more aggressive contact while others prefer a gentler sweep this is where trying a few different shapes helps you build a personalized routine.

Material and maintenance

Most Aneros products are silicone which is body safe and easy to clean. Silicone surface holds lubrication well and stays smooth for many sessions. If you are sensitive to latex you will be happy to know that silicone toys do not require latex compatibility considerations. After use clean with warm water and a mild soap or a dedicated toy cleaner and allow it to dry completely before storage. Proper maintenance extends the life of the toy and keeps it hygienic for repeated use.

Lubrication needs

Lubrication is essential for comfortable insertion and smooth movement. Use a high quality water based lubricant for silicone toys as it protects the surface and reduces friction. If you are using a water based lube you can reapply as needed without worrying about damaging the toy. Avoid using oil based lubes near silicone as they can degrade the material and shorten the toy life. There are also hybrid lubricants that mix water and silicone based formulas but for most players water based is the safest and most reliable choice.

Prep steps before you begin

Preparation matters. You want your body to be relaxed and your mind calm so your pelvic floor can open and stay engaged during the experience. Here is a short prep routine you can adapt to your schedule and mood.

  • Wash hands and clean the toy to avoid introducing bacteria into the anal canal.
  • Set aside a comfortable space with privacy. Dim lights and a soft soundtrack can help you focus and reduce tension.
  • Warm up with breath work. Slow inhales through the nose and exhale through the mouth help you relax and prepare the pelvic floor for a comfortable insertion.
  • Apply generous lubrication to both the toy and the opening. More is better here because friction is your enemy when you want smooth moves.
  • Take your time with insertion. If you feel resistance pause and adjust your position or relax further. Do not force the toy into place.

Insertion and initial positioning

Finding a comfortable position is the next stage. A few positions tend to work well for hands free use and you can switch between them as you warm up and go deeper.

On your back with legs up

Lying on your back with knees drawn toward the chest provides a compact channel for the toy to sit along the natural curve of the spine. This position gives you the best chance of full contact with the prostate as gravity helps the device stay in place. It also leaves your hands completely free to explore other sensations such as chest stimulation or partner touch if you are playing with someone else.

Side lying with one leg bent

Side lying is a great low intensity option that reduces stress on the pelvic floor. It is easier to adjust the angle of the device and you can breathe more deeply which helps keep the muscles relaxed. This position is ideal for longer sessions where you want a steady rhythm without strain.

kneeling or standing with support

For those who enjoy mobility or want to use a partner as a stabilizing influence kneeling or a supported standing stance can work. Use a wall or sturdy furniture for balance. This approach helps you experiment with subtle shifts in angle and pressure to tailor the stimulation to your personal preference.

Technique for hands free stimulation

The core idea is to let the pelvic floor do most of the work while the device sits and repeats a pattern that excites the prostate. You will feel waves of pressure building from the base of the penis and moving inward toward the prostate. The key is consistency over brute force. Here are practical steps to guide you through a typical session.

Breath and stillness

Start with slow breathing and focus on relaxing the pelvic floor. A calm breath helps prevent clenching and makes it easier for the device to settle into the right angle. Don’t hurry the process be patient and give your body time to adjust to the sensations.

Micro movements and positional tweaks

Because you are playing hands free small shifts in the hips and torso can shift the angle of the device slightly. Make tiny adjustments for example a quarter turn of the hips can change the contact and intensity. Keep movement minimal at first and increase only as comfort and control improve.

Exploring pressure levels

Begin with light contact and gradually increase pressure as your body tells you it is ready. If you push too hard you risk discomfort or losing the correct contact. Let the device guide the depth and pressure while you enjoy the build up and subtle tremors that come with it.

Climax and aftercare

Some users experience a powerful prostate orgasm while others feel waves of warmth and tingling. Both outcomes are normal. After the peak spend a few minutes breathing slowly and allow the muscles to relax. Gently remove the toy and clean it as soon as possible to maintain hygiene for your next session.

Safety guidelines and common sense tips

Like all intimate toys safety matters. The body has boundaries and you should honor them at all times. Here are essential safety tips to ensure you have a positive experience every time.

  • Never force entry. If there is resistance back off and try a different angle or take a break.
  • Communicate with partners about what you are comfortable trying if you are playing together. Consent and comfort come first even in kink heavy scenes.
  • Inspect the toy before each use for cracks or rough spots that can cause injury. If you notice any damage do not use the device.
  • Keep the device clean. Anal play carries bacteria into the urinary tract if not cleaned properly. A quick wash with warm water and mild soap after each session is enough for most models.
  • Medical considerations matter. If you have a history of anal fissures hemorrhoids or recent surgery talk to a healthcare professional before starting a hands free prostate routine.

Maintenance and cleaning basics

After every session clean the device thoroughly. Use warm water and mild soap or a dedicated toy cleaner. Dry with a soft lint free cloth and allow to air dry completely before storing. Store away from direct sunlight in a clean dry place. If you own multiple devices rotate their use to prevent friction wear on any single unit and give each a longer life span.

Common issues and troubleshooting

Not every session will be perfect right away. Here are typical problems and practical fixes that will keep your practice on track.

  • Discomfort after insertion fix by re applying lubricant or trying a smaller model until your body warms up.
  • Loss of contact due to movement slow and adjust your position or use a lighter touch for a few minutes to reestablish contact.
  • Over stimulating the area if you feel pain stop and rest. Start again with gentler pressure when you are ready.
  • Difficulty removing the toy if the angle is awkward take a few breaths and gently ease it out with a slow tilt rather than pulling straight out.

FAQ

What is a hands free prostate massage device

A hands free device sits inside the anus and applies pressure to the prostate without needing manual movement. The device relies on body mechanics and controlled angles to maintain contact while the user breathes and relaxes.

Are Aneros toys safe for beginners

Yes with proper use and hygiene Aneros devices are suitable for beginners. Start with smaller models and focus on comfort and relaxation before moving to more advanced shapes.

Do I need lube for hands free play

Lubrication is essential for all anal play. Use a high quality water based lubricant especially on silicone toys to reduce friction and protect the surface of the toy.

Can I use silicone lube with silicone toys

Water based lubricants are generally recommended for silicone toys to preserve the surface. If you choose a silicone friendly lube confirm compatibility with your specific toy model.

How long should a first session last

Beginners often start with short sessions around 10 to 15 minutes. You can gradually extend as you become more comfortable but always listen to your body and stop if you feel any pain or undue discomfort.

Is prostate massage safe for everyone

Most adults with no medical contraindications can participate in prostate massage. If you have hemorrhoids recent surgery a urinary tract infection or any other medical condition consult a healthcare professional before trying hands free play.

Can I use Aneros devices with a partner

Absolutely. A partner can help with positioning provide sensory feedback or participate in a shared exploration. Always discuss boundaries and signals before starting and maintain ongoing consent throughout the session.

How do I clean and store my toy

Clean with warm water and mild soap or a dedicated toy cleaner after each use. Dry thoroughly and store in a clean dry place away from direct sunlight. Keeping a clean routine helps your toy last longer and keeps you healthier.

What is the best way to learn hands free technique

Start with a simple model and a relaxed mind. Focus on breathing keep your pelvis loose and let the device guide your movement. Practice makes progress so be patient and keep a journal of what works for you.
